USB Travel Drives Just Keep Getting Smaller

We’ve all seen tiny travel drives that are about the size of a stick of gum, but now there’s an even smaller travel drive that fits in your wrist watch! There are several different versions of the product out there. Some of these awesome time pieces actually contain a tiny USB drive in them—just pop it out and plug it into your computer to access your files. Others have the drive built in and feature a retractable USB cord to actually connect the entire watch to your computer. Either way, both are very cool. Of course, these are mostly nifty toys instead of hard core USB storage. Most only hold around 4 GB of data at most, so don’t expect to cart your entire collection of AutoCAD files around on your watch. For most people, though, 4 GB provides plenty of space, and you’ll feel like James Bond as you save your documents to your watch.
